Best time to fly to Kakabeka Falls

The most popular months for travelers to fly to Kakabeka Falls are April, May, and July, when peak temperatures in Kakabeka Falls can reach up to 63.5°F in July. If you prefer quieter travel, consider November, the least busy and relatively cheaper time to visit with fewer crowds and temperatures around 30.6°F. For better deals, September usually offers the lowest average one-way fare around $191, roughly 23% cheaper than the yearly average. Looking for additional cheaper months to fly? August, May, and June offer average one-way fares roughly ranging from $194 to $205, making them good options for flexible travelers.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Check carefully that you don't have sharp objects (like a pocket knife) hiding in one of the compartments of your carry-on luggage. Other restricted items include flammable or explosive products, such as fuel and matches, and liquids and gels in containers with a capacity of more than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ters).

What to wear on a flight:

  • The narrow aisles of an airplane are no place for a fashion parade. Don comfortable layers and take a sweater as it can get quite cool in the cabin. Flat, enclosed shoes are also a good idea.
  • Most of us have heard about DVT (deep vein thrombosis), a blood clotting condition caused by reduced mobility or inactivity. There are numerous ways to lower your risk. Wear a quality pair of compression socks, drink lots of water and remember to keep your legs and feet moving. Walk the aisles of the cabin or perform some simple exercises in your seat.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Kakabeka Falls?
Being prepared before you get to the airport will make your trip to Kakabeka Falls a pleasure. Below you'll find some handy tips and tricks for a stress-free journey past security:

  • Airport security personnel first need to establish that you have a valid ID and matching boarding pass before you can proceed any further. Keep them within easy reach.
  • The X-ray machine comes next. Empty your pockets and remove anything that is likely to set off the scanner's alarm. This includes things like earphones or headphones, as well as heavy jackets or coats. They'll need to be placed on the conveyor belt for screening.
  • Your electronic devices like phones and laptops will also have to go through the machine for inspection. Don't worry, you'll be back online before you know it.
  • Remove all liquids and gels from your carry-on luggage. They often need to be sent through the X-ray machine separately. Each product should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it in a single quart-size (one liter), clear zip-close b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a practical footwear choice as you're less likely to have to remove them when passing through security. Big boots and other heavy-style sh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, pack them in your checked baggage. They won't be allowed in the cabin.
